Golden Eagle football program signs five-year uniform deal with Adidas


COOKEVILLE, Tenn. – The Tennessee Tech football team will hit the field this fall with, quite literally, a whole new look.

Yes, the Golden Eagles will have a new look in their game plan, brought to the field by new head coach Marcus Satterfield.

But the team’s new look will also feature a change in appearance -- Tech will be clad in new uniforms after the football program signed a five-year deal with apparel powerhouse Adidas.

“Tech football and the all-new ‘Tech Tuff’ brand is excited to have Adidas as the sponsor for all Golden Eagle football uniforms, apparel, shoes and gear,” Satterfield said.

“To have Adidas as our provider will help us to soar into the next phase of Tennessee Tech football. It is a brand that is recognized worldwide for its quality and excellence. This agreement shows our players, fans and recruits our commitment to be the best football program in the country.”

Satterfield said the seeds have been sown for winning championships, and the new uniform deal with Adidas adds to the momentum.

“We are excited to outfit our players and team from head to the toe in the best, and Adidas is synonymous with the best,” Satterfield said. “We are excited to have them join us in this championship process.”
